Research Abstract |
We studied these themes shown below. (1) Expression of telomerase activity between cell lines established from human oral squamous cell carcinomas and primary cultured keratinocytes from noraml oral cavities (2) Expression of telomerase activity between oral squamous cell carcinoma tissues, leukoplakias and normal mucosa from oral cavities We detected high telomerase activity in all cell lines though 2cell lines showed statistically lower activity than others. But the reasons or the genetical difference for example, expression level of protein of p53, p16 and EGFR still remain unclear. In 6 cell lines, we reported previously mutation of p53 or H-ras, we found that both pathway of p53 and Rb were disrupted samely as shown by Winberg et al. We detected telomerase activity in 77% of oral squamous cell carcinoma tissues and 47% of leukoplakias while all normal tissues showed no telomerase activity. The activity of the carcinoma tissues showed higher than these of leukoplakias. Furthermore, we detected telomerase activity in 47% of leukoplakias, in spite of almost all lekoplakias we analized showed slight dysplasia. It might suggests that telomerase is activated and cells itself start to gain the ability of immortalization even in the early stage of precancer.
